none of the previous crystal chronicles have been "definitive hits". they're all modest sellers at best. so expecting this one to be different "because its FF", is ludicrous.

The Crystal Chronicles series has never been a chart-topping series. The best selling CC game to date is the original on the GCN, with 1.38 million in sales. The DS iterations have averaged 500,000 units apiece.

With this being the first full-fledged console Crystal Chronicles, and a 55M console userbase, I expect it to be a modest hit. With anywhere between 2-2.5 million sales.
